lundi 29 octobre 2012

4D Sur connnexion web

La journée du vendredi se déroule pour chaque étudiant au rythme des connexions web sur leur serveur web 4D afin de découvrir de nouvelles balises HTML 4D et avancer dans la mise en pratique des principes de programmation avec 4D serveur web.




Quelques exercices permettent de mettre en pratique la balise 4DLOOP afin d'utiliser une boucle dans un page web pour afficher la liste des projets, la liste des risques et la liste des actions.
Puis réalisation de nouveaux exercices pour afficher un projet en modification dans un formulaire et enregistrer les modifications faites dans les champs du formulaire web dans la base de données 4D. La gestion de l'accès au page à partir de la méthode base Sur connexion web est séparée de  la gestion du contenu par l'utilisation de balise 4DSCRIPT/ dans les pages HTML. Les verrous de sécurité de 4D ne donnant pas un accès par défaut aux méthodes existantes à partir de la balise 4DSCRIPT/, plusieurs étudiants cherchent pourquoi leurs pages web s'affichent mal. Après avoir coché la propriété "Disponible via les balises HTML et les URLs 4D" tout fonctionne beaucoup mieux. Rien ne vaut la pratique pour retenir la théorie.

Les étudiants les plus avancés se lancent dans la réalisation de l'affichage d'une matrice des risques en fonction des indices de criticité.